A faithful reissue4
This s an exact replica of the 1956 LP soundtrack, only now it is in true stereophonic sound. George Duning's score is unique and sticks in the memory. The marriage of "Moonglow" and the "Love Theme" (from the dance scene) is a masterpiece and will stimulate in your mind the visuals which it accompanies. The sound is quite good considering the age of the tape masters.
